Choosing the Right Materials for Your Roof

Asphalt Shingles: Popular and Cost-Effective

Asphalt shingles are the most common roofing material in Toronto due to their cost-effectiveness and good performance in varied weather conditions. They are designed to resist extreme weather and come in a variety of colors and styles, making them a versatile choice for many homeowners.

Metal Roofing: Durability and Longevity

Metal roofing is another excellent option for Toronto homes. Known for its durability and resistance to harsh weather, metal roofing can last up to 50 years or more. It is also fire-resistant and can help reduce energy costs by reflecting sunlight away from the home.

Flat Roofing: Ideal for Modern Homes

Flat roofs are particularly popular in modern architectural designs. Materials commonly used for flat roofing in Toronto include EPDM, PVC, and TPO, which are known for their longevity and resistance to leaks. Proper drainage is crucial to prevent water accumulation and protect the structural integrity of your home.

Weather Challenges and Solutions

Winter Weather: Snow and Ice

Toronto’s winters can be harsh on roofs due to heavy snowfall and ice dams. It’s important to ensure your roof has proper insulation and ventilation to prevent ice dam formation, which can cause water to back up and leak into your home.

Summer Weather: Heat and UV Radiation

During the summer, UV rays and heat can cause roofing materials to deteriorate over time. Choosing materials that are UV-resistant can help mitigate these effects. Proper attic ventilation is also crucial to reduce heat buildup and prevent premature aging of your roofing materials.

Sustainability and Eco-Friendly Roofing

Green Roofing Options

With growing environmental concerns, many Toronto homeowners are opting for green roofing solutions. Green roofs are not only aesthetically pleasing but also provide excellent insulation, reduce runoff, and improve air quality.

Solar Roofing Integration

Solar panels can be integrated into various roofing materials, allowing homeowners to generate their own electricity. This is not only environmentally friendly but can also offer significant savings on energy bills.
